Drill and blast contractors Enjoy a pivotal position in mining, quarrying, and enormous-scale construction tasks. These professionals are liable for breaking up rock in addition to other hard components to get ready internet sites For added excavation, building, or resource extraction. Their abilities makes certain operations run smoothly, successf